How they compare

United States of America currently reports 55,998 USD against 50,009 USD in Spain, a difference of 5,989 USD.

That makes United States of America's figure about 1.1 times Spain's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 7 shared years of data; in 2018 it was United States of America ahead.

Spain ranks 1st and United States of America ranks 1st of 38 countries.

United States of America has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

This sub-domain contains data on agriculture producer prices and the producer price index. Agriculture producer prices are prices received by farmers for primary crops, live animals and livestock primary products as collected at the point of initial sale (prices paid at the farm gate). Annual data are provided from 1991 (while mothly data start in January 2010) for 180 countries and 212 products. The producer price index is the index of agricultural producer prices that measures the average annual change over time in the selling prices received by farmers (prices at the farm gate or at the first point of sale). The three categories of producer price index available in FAOSTAT comprise: single-item price index, commodity group index and the agriculture producer price index.
